Re: [PATCH 6/6 (v4)] support for path name caching in rev-cache

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



An update to caching mechanism, allowing path names to be cached for blob and tree objects. A list of names appearing in each cache slice is appended to the end of the slice, which is referenced by variable-sized indexes per entry. This allows pack-objects to more intelligently schedule unpacked/poorly packed object, and enables proper duplication of rev-list's behaivor.

The mechanism for this involves adding a 'name' field to blob and tree objects, mainly to facilitate reuse of caches during maintenence (like the 'unique' field).
